Yountville Vintage Brut, 2006

Winery Exclusive
The first in a series of three Vintage Bruts highlighting the special characteristics of Chandon’s estate vineyard appellations.

Food Pairing

The full-bodied structure and layered complexity of this wine make it an appealing choice with food. Rich and nutty characters marry beautifully with salty, creamy foods like Oysters Rockefeller. Try it with robust roasted dishes or Asian shortribs.

Tasting Notes

In the glass, the color is a dramatic deep pink with a blush of sunset. Intense ripe strawberry, juicy watermelon, and fresh red cherry fruit aromas and flavors are interwoven with apple, pear, and stone fruit. On the palate, the wine is creamy and seductive, with defined structure from the addition of still Pinot Noir at triage. The overall impression is one of bold vibrancy and impact from start to finish.

Mt. Veeder Blanc de Blancs, 2004

Winery Exclusive
The second in a series of three Vintage Bruts highlighting the special characteristics of Chandon’s estate vineyard appellations.

Food Pairing

The smoky and nutty qualities of this wine make it a natural match for smoked clams. It would pair well with anything from the sea from caviar to lobster.

Tasting Notes

This austere and complex wine opens smoky aromas of Marmite, malt, ginger and citrus. In addition to these aromas, almond and dried fig notes persist on the layered palate.
